I used beautiful faceted Blue Chalcedony flat disc beads and finished this bracelet with iridescent Delica Glass beads and a Sterling Silver lobster claw clasp. It's 7 1/4 inches long and really is lovely!

Chalcedony is a member of the Quartz family with a cryptocrystalline structure, perfect for magnifying its crystal energy to soothe and restore balance, from the conscious mind to the inner child, all the way down to the animal self. Its name may be derived from the Greek port city of Chalcedon. The ancient civilizations of Egypt, Greece and Rome used varieties of Chalcedony in jewelry and carvings, and, as gems of antiquity, they were believed to imbue their holders with certain powers.
